We are seeking a motivated and skilled Associate Litigation Attorney to join our dedicated team. This role is ideal for an attorney with 1–4 years of experience in estate, trust, and commercial litigation. Other areas of litigation include real estate and domestic relations. The candidate should be able to provide excellent legal representation and compassionate client service in sensitive and complex matters. The Associate will assist a senior partner with existing litigation as well as manage a caseload from inception to resolution under the guidance of a senior partner. Responsibilities: • Case Management: Manage all phases of litigation. • Pleadings and Motions: Draft, review, and file various legal documents, including petitions, complaints, motions, discovery requests and responses, trial briefs, and settlement agreements. • Court Appearances: Represent clients effectively in court at hearings, mediations, settlement conferences, and trials. • Discovery: Conduct and manage the discovery process, including preparing financial disclosures, taking and defending depositions, and analyzing financial records. • Client Communication: Maintain regular, clear, and empathetic communication with clients, providing legal advice, explaining case strategy, and managing expectations. • Negotiation: Skillfully negotiate settlements and resolutions outside of court to achieve the best possible outcomes for clients. • Legal Research: Conduct thorough legal research and analysis to support case strategy and advise senior partners. Qualifications: Experience: • 1–4 years of demonstrated experience in litigation. Education: • Juris Doctor (J.D.) degree from an accredited law school. Licensure: • Must be an active member in good standing of the Nebraska State Bar. Skills: • Litigation Skills: Proven ability to handle court appearances and manage contested litigation. • Financial Acumen: Strong understanding of financial disclosures, asset tracing, and business valuation principles. • Empathy & Professionalism: Exceptional ability to handle high-conflict situations with professionalism, compassion, and sound judgment. • Organization: Excellent time management, organizational, and file management skills. Compensation: $65,000 - $80,000 yearly
